Stefan Monnier
1b1ffe0789 (Ffunction): Make interpreted closures safe for space
Interpreted closures currently just grab a reference to the complete
lexical environment, so (lambda (x) (+ x y)) can end up looking like

    (closure ((foo ...) (y 7) (bar ...) ...)
             (x) (+ x y))

where the foo/bar/... bindings are not only useless but can prevent
the GC from collecting that memory (i.e. it's a representation that is
not "safe for space") and it can also make that closure "unwritable"
(or more specifically, it can cause the closure's print
representation to be u`read`able).

Compiled closures don't suffer from this problem because `cconv.el`
actually looks at the code and only stores in the compiled closure
those variables which are actually used.

So, we fix this discrepancy by letting the existing code in `cconv.el` tell
`Ffunction` which variables are actually used by the body of the
function such that it can filter out the irrelevant elements and
return a closure of the form:

    (closure ((y 7)) (x) (+ x y))

Mattias Engdegård
60102016e4 Abolish max-specpdl-size (bug#57911)
The max-lisp-eval-depth limit is sufficient to prevent unbounded stack
growth including the specbind stack; simplify matters for the user by
not having them to worry about two different limits.  This change
turns max-specpdl-size into a harmless variable with no effects,
to keep existing code happy.

Stefan Monnier
6f973faa91 cl-generic: Use OClosures for cl--generic-isnot-nnm-p
Rewrite the handling of `cl-no-next-method` to get rid of the hideous
hack used in `cl--generic-isnot-nnm-p` and also to try and move
some of the cost to the construction of the effective method rather
than its invocation.  This speeds up method calls measurably when
there's a `cl-call-next-method` in the body.
